Transaction ff017336b495623669a74fe78963d70a4a2ae7b7008834ffc0e1ca63ae5263cc
1 Input
2 Outputs
- ff017336b495623669a74fe78963d70a4a2ae7b7008834ffc0e1ca63ae5263cc:0
- ff017336b495623669a74fe78963d70a4a2ae7b7008834ffc0e1ca63ae5263cc:1
value 1666576
address mz7dc4UqEmmekLuDQcb6PCngFLHKhYAsQ4
value 4190634055
address mr2PU5KXJjEozBw3XnM8HMgSzhd9TURLqM